轮播

题目1: 轮播的实现原理是怎样的?如果让你来实现,你会抽象出哪些函数(or接口)供使用?(比如 play())
将需要轮播的图片排成一行,并在需要显示图片的位置开上一个同一张图片尺寸大小相同的窗口,该窗口设置属性overflow: hidden,然后控制图片层的左右拖动,进而实现轮播效果。利用人眼的视觉差,在最后一张图片后面加上第一张图片并且瞬间切换至第一张,反复这样操作就会让人产生图片无限滚动的错觉。并且点击下面页标跳转到相应页面上。需要设置状态锁,触发时加锁,动效完毕后回调开锁。
滑动型:if判断重置 渐变型:利用%计算的循环特性
play() playPre() playNext() setBullet()

题目2: 实现视频中的左右滚动无限循环轮播效果
demo

题目3: 实现一个渐变轮播效果, 效果范例198
demo
http://js.jirengu.com/pudixahehe/3/edit

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 题目1: 轮播的实现原理是怎样的?如果让你来实现,你会抽象出哪些函数(or接口)供使用?(比如 play()) 左...
    cctosuper阅读 1,813评论 0 0
  • Android 自定义View的各种姿势1 Activity的显示之ViewRootImpl详解 Activity...
    passiontim阅读 175,791评论 25 709
  • 1- 轮播的实现原理是怎样的?如果实现,会抽象出哪些函数(or接口)供使用?(比如 play()) 轮播的原理实际...
    osborne阅读 3,652评论 0 1
  • 题目1: 轮播的实现原理是怎样的?如果让你来实现,你会抽象出哪些函数(or接口)供使用?(比如 play()) 1...
    南山码农阅读 5,005评论 0 1
  • 利川有许多美食。柏杨的豆干,建南的咸菜,福宝山的莼菜,南坪的黄鳝……,至于我的家乡汪营镇主要有魔芋鸭...
    松筠深锁阅读 5,673评论 0 3